Sourcing guidance for Electric Tipper Truck

What are the key technical specifications to evaluate when sourcing an Electric Tipper Truck?

Buyers must prioritize the Battery Capacity (kWh) and Battery Type (typically LFP - Lithium Iron Phosphate) to ensure sufficient range and safety. Key performance metrics include the Payload Capacity (tons), Maximum Gradeability (usually ≥20%) for steep terrains, and the Motor Peak Power (kW). Additionally, verify the Hydraulic Lifting System's efficiency and the Charging Time (DC Fast Charging support) to minimize operational downtime.

Which international compliance standards and certifications are mandatory for these vehicles?

For global trade, ensure the vehicle meets ISO 9001 for manufacturing quality. Depending on the target market, look for CE Marking (Europe), DOT/EPA compliance (USA), or WVTA (Whole Vehicle Type Approval). It is critical to verify UN38.3 certification for battery transport safety and IEC 62196 standards for charging interface compatibility.

How does the usage scenario affect the choice of an Electric Tipper Truck?

For underground mining, focus on compact dimensions and zero-emission certifications to meet ventilation requirements. For urban construction, prioritize noise reduction features and regenerative braking systems to extend battery life during frequent stop-and-go cycles. For heavy-duty off-road use, ensure the chassis has reinforced suspension and a high IP67/IP69K rating for dust and water resistance.

What are the maintenance requirements for electric vs. diesel tipper trucks?

Electric tippers offer a lower Total Cost of Ownership (TCO) due to fewer moving parts. Maintenance should focus on Thermal Management Systems (coolant levels), Battery Health Monitoring (BMS), and High-Voltage Cable inspections. Unlike diesel trucks, there is no need for engine oil changes, fuel filters, or urea (AdBlue) refills, significantly reducing long-term labor costs.

Cross-Border Procurement & Risk Management for Electric Heavy Machinery

What are the primary risks when importing Electric Tipper Trucks from overseas?

The most significant risk is Battery Degradation during long-term sea transit; ensure the supplier maintains the battery at an optimal State of Charge (SoC) of 30-50%. Another risk is Technical Incompatibility with local charging infrastructure; always confirm the Plug Type (CCS1, CCS2, or GB/T) and voltage requirements before shipment.

What shipping methods are recommended for heavy electric vehicles?

Due to the weight and dimensions, Ro-Ro (Roll-on/Roll-off) shipping is the safest and most cost-effective method. If using Flat Rack Containers, ensure the vehicle is strictly secured and the Lithium Battery is declared as Class 9 Dangerous Goods to comply with IMDG (International Maritime Dangerous Goods) codes.

How can transaction security be guaranteed in high-value B2B trades?

Utilize Secured Payment Services provided by platforms like Made-in-China.com to ensure funds are only released upon proof of shipment. Additionally, hire a Third-Party Inspection Agency (like SGS or Bureau Veritas) to conduct a Pre-Shipment Inspection (PSI) to verify the truck's functionality and battery health.
